Transaction 3c88db2717424d9c9cf2f36df4e36028d54064d0d48459374535e60c3d1a2663

1 Input
2 Outputs
  • 3c88db2717424d9c9cf2f36df4e36028d54064d0d48459374535e60c3d1a2663:0
  • value  509664283
    address  1PHi1FPeX7jyv2gdpdsfBxyHW1xkNDN1jA
  • 3c88db2717424d9c9cf2f36df4e36028d54064d0d48459374535e60c3d1a2663:1
  • value  39156000
    address  3Fd9njMjbWQRYqfRz1icmZkLfizuFsZVo2